Understanding the Meaning of LLP Registration in India
An LLP is a recognised business model where two or more individuals join together to run commercial or professional activities under a recognised legal entity. Unlike a normal partnership, an LLP has a distinct legal identity apart from its partners. This means the LLP can own assets, sign contracts, open bank accounts, hire employees and operate business in its own name. At the same time, the financial liability of partners is generally restricted to their decided contribution, which helps reduce personal financial risk. This balance between flexibility and protection is one of the primary reasons why LLP registration in India has become a preferred option among today’s business owners.

LLP Registration Process
The process of llp registration in india generally begins with selecting a suitable business name. The name should be distinct, relevant to the business activity and compliant with naming rules. After that, designated partners need digital authentication for filing documents electronically. The proposed LLP must have at least two designated partners, and necessary identification and address documents are required. Once the name is cleared, incorporation documents are drafted and submitted with details of partners, registered office information and business activity details. After approval, the LLP receives formal incorporation recognition and can begin its operations as a legal entity.
Role of the LLP Agreement
The LLP agreement is one of the most important documents after registration. It outlines the relationship among partners and the internal operating rules of the business. A properly drafted agreement can include details such as capital contribution, profit sharing ratio, duties of partners, voting rights, new partner admission, resignation process, dispute handling and business management rules. Without a clear agreement, misunderstandings may occur when the business expands or faces challenges. This is why every LLP should give proper attention to drafting an agreement that matches the expectations and responsibilities of all partners.

Compliance Requirements After LLP Registration
After registration, an LLP must maintain proper records and complete required filings within the required timelines. Compliance may include annual filings, financial statements, income reporting and updates for changes in partners or registered office. Even though LLP compliance is generally seen as simpler than certain other business structures, it should not be neglected. Timely compliance helps maintain active status, protects business credibility and avoids penalties. Responsible record-keeping also helps partners review business performance, manage taxation and plan future growth.
